What is Cancer Breast ?

Cancer breast is a disease in which cells malignant grow not controlled on the network breasts . Although more often attack women , cancer this is also possible occurs in men (1% of cases ). In Indonesia, Globocan 2020 data take notes 65,858 cases new cancer breasts in women , making it cancer is the most common disease in Indonesia.


Subtype Cancer Breast Cancer : Types, Therapy , and Impact on Prognosis

Cancer breast No disease single . Subtype cancer breast determined by expression receptor cell cancer , which affects therapy and prognosis. Here are 4 subtypes main :


1. Luminal A

· Receptors : ER+, PR+, HER2-

· Characteristics : Growth slow , best prognosis

· Therapy : Therapy hormones (Tamoxifen, Aromatase Inhibitors)

2. Luminal B

· Receptors : ER+, PR+/-, HER2+/-

· Characteristics : More aggressive from Luminal A

· Therapy : Combination therapy hormones + chemotherapy ± HER2 targeted therapy

3. HER2-Enriched

· Receptors : ER-, PR-, HER2+

· Characteristics : Aggressive , but response Good with targeted therapy

· Therapy : Trastuzumab (Herceptin®), Pertuzumab

4. Triple-Negative Breast Cancer (TNBC)

· Receptors : ER-, PR-, HER2-

· Characteristics : Most aggressive , risk relapse tall

· Therapy : Chemotherapy ± immunotherapy ( Example : Pembrolizumab)

 

Cancer Prognosis Breast Based on Subtype

Subtype

5 Year Survival Rate

Risk Recurrence

Luminal A

90-95%

Low

Luminal B

80-85%

Currently

HER2-Enriched

75-80%*

Tall**

TNBC

60-70%

Very high

 

Mammaprint : Test Genetics For Personalization Therapy

Mammaprint is test genetics revolutionary that analyzes 70 genes to predict risk relapse . The main benefits :

1. Determine need chemotherapy addition

2. Avoid overtreatment of patients risk low

3. Guiding decision therapy more accurate

 

Prevention Cancer Breast with a SMART Lifestyle Pattern

Indonesian Ministry of Health recommends SMART :

· Routine health checks ( mammography / breast ultrasound )

· E get rid of cigarette smoke

· Be diligent in activity physical (minimum 30 minutes / day )

· Nutritional diet balanced ( high) fiber , low fat)

· Rest Enough

· Manage stress

 

FAQ About Cancer Breast

Q: What are the symptoms? cancer breasts that need be aware of ?

A: Lump hard in the breast , changes skin ( such as skin oranges ), and butts enter to in .


Q: Can TNBC be cured ?

A: Yes, with combination chemotherapy and immunotherapy . Detection early become key main !


Q: How? method screening cancer breasts ?

A: SADARI ( examine) breast own ) monthly + mammography annual For age >40 years .
